Research Outpatient Physical Therapist Job Trends in Newton Upper Falls

If you’re a Outpatient Physical Therapist curious about Travel job trends in Newton Upper Falls, MA, AMN Healthcare has successfully filled 6 similar positions in the area, providing insight into the opportunities you could expect. These previously filled roles offered competitive pay, with an average weekly rate of $2,155 and a range from $1,893 to $2,495 per week, showcasing the strong earning potential for professionals in this field.

Positions were located in key zip codes, including 02464. These placements reflect the high demand for skilled Outpatient Physical Therapists in Newton Upper Falls’s thriving healthcare landscape. Join a well-established outpatient physical therapy clinic in Lexington, Massachusetts, a town known for its rich Revolutionary War history, tree-lined neighborhoods, and welcoming New England charm. Lexington offers a blend of historic landmarks, vibrant town centers, and easy access to Boston while maintaining a small-town feel. Residents enjoy top-rated schools, beautifully maintained parks, and extensive walking and biking trails, including the popular Minuteman Bikeway. The community’s emphasis on wellness, education, and civic engagement makes it an appealing place to both live and work. This position is based in a modern outpatient clinic designed to support efficient, patient-centered care. You will work with a collaborative team of therapists and support staff focused on evidence-based practice and positive patient outcomes. The clinic sees a broad range of orthopedic and sports-related conditions, post-surgical cases, and general musculoskeletal disorders, offering a diverse caseload that supports ongoing clinical growth and skill refinement. A typical day includes comprehensive evaluations, one-on-one treatment sessions, development and progression of individualized care plans, and clear communication with referring providers. You will document care in an EMR system, coordinate with front office and support staff to optimize patient flow, and participate in team huddles or case discussions as needed. Patient volumes and scheduling are structured to balance productivity with quality of care, allowing you to focus on meaningful patient interactions and measurable functional gains. Shifts generally align with clinic hours that include a mix of daytime and some early evening availability to accommodate patient schedules. The environment is supportive, with opportunities to learn from colleagues, share best practices, and engage in continuing education. You will be part of a team that values professional growth, collaboration, and a culture of respect and inclusion.

In this role, you will work in an outpatient rehabilitation setting focused on delivering high-quality, patient-centered care to a diverse caseload. Typical patients may include individuals recovering from orthopedic surgeries, sports injuries, spine conditions, and chronic musculoskeletal disorders, as well as those needing balance, gait, or general functional rehabilitation. You will perform comprehensive evaluations, develop individualized plans of care, implement evidence-based interventions, and regularly reassess progress toward functional goals. Your typical day will include a mix of initial evaluations, follow-up treatment sessions, and patient education. You will collaborate with referring physicians and other healthcare professionals to ensure continuity of care and to optimize patient outcomes. The environment is designed to support efficient patient flow while maintaining the time and attention needed for personalized care. Patient volumes are structured to allow thorough assessments, treatments, and documentation without sacrificing quality. Support staff and other team members assist with scheduling, equipment needs, and coordination to help you focus on clinical excellence. The clinic is equipped with modern rehabilitation tools and equipment to support a wide range of therapies, including therapeutic exercise, manual therapy, neuromuscular re-education, balance and proprioceptive training, and functional strengthening. You will have the opportunity to incorporate current best practices and outcome measures into daily practice and to participate in ongoing quality improvement and clinical development initiatives. Shifts are typically scheduled during daytime and early evening hours on weekdays, with structured schedules that support work-life balance. The consistent schedule allows you to build strong relationships with your patients and to follow them through their entire course of care.
